LETTERS FROM THE COLONY Launch Video For New Single “Galax” And It’s Prog!

LETTERS FROM THE COLONY are your newest prog kids on the block. Hailing from the small town of Borlänge, central Sweden the quintet is an amalgamation of young, artistic and exceptional musicians who are determined to channel their thoughts in a creative and at the same time, an extreme way. LETTERS FROM THE COLONY spawned back in 2010, and since the very first day of their existence they have been determined on bringing something new and virgin to the metal scene. Just adding the right amount of progressiveness, melded with extreme technical aspects the band now is ready to unleash their all new debut studio album, which is releasing tomorrow, out via Nuclear Blast. It’s a progressive extreme metal album, entitled, ‘Vignette‘.

In anticipation of their debut release the band has released a music video for their third single, “Galax“, which is an eight minute long progressive number with a couple of chuggy and extreme metal thrown in there. I’d say it sounds really good. Check out the video attached below!

Songwriter Sebastian Svalland states: “This is a song that has a bit of everything in the LETTERS FROM THE COLONY spectrum – enjoy!”

The band deliver highly complex songs full of unbound aggression and progressive structures in the vein of MESHUGGAH, OPETH or GOJIRA and also do not shy away from playing saxophone with a guitar or sampling the call of a deer into a track!

LETTERS FROM THE COLONY are:
Alexander Backlund – Vocals
Sebastian Svalland – Guitar
Johan Jönsegård – Guitar
Emil Östberg – Bass
Jonas Sköld – Drums
